The Philadelphia Eagles (4-0) take on the Los Angeles Rams (2-2) in Week 5 of the 2023 NFL season.
Both teams enter the matchup fresh off of overtime wins. Philly beat the Washington Commanders 34-31, while the Rams took down the Indianapolis Colts 29-23.
Will you be able to watch this week's game on TV? If you live in the red areas on the map below you’ll get this game on your local FOX channels, according to 506sports.com:

Kickoff for Eagles vs. Rams is at 4:05 p.m. ET with Kevin Burkhardt and Greg Olsen calling the game on FOX.
These two teams haven't met since September of 2020 when the Rams beat the Eagles brutally, 37-19.
Things will look different this time as Jalen Hurts is no longer a rookie and Jared Goff is no longer leading the Rams.
The Eagles are dealing with some injuries on their defense, including to veteran star defensive tackle Fletcher Cox (back). As for the Rams, quarterback Matthew Stafford plans to play through a hip injury that he suffered in last week's win.
